مشاركة عبر


PoolPatchParameter interface

واجهة تمثل PoolPatchParameter.

الخصائص

applicationPackageReferences

قائمة الحزم التي سيتم تثبيتها على كل عقدة حساب في التجمع. تؤثر التغييرات على مراجع الحزمة على جميع العقد الجديدة التي تنضم إلى التجمع، ولكن لا تؤثر على حساب العقد الموجودة بالفعل في التجمع حتى يتم إعادة تمهيدها أو إعادة تصورها. إذا كان هذا العنصر موجودا، فإنه يحل محل أي مراجع حزمة موجودة. إذا قمت بتحديد مجموعة فارغة، فستتم إزالة كافة مراجع الحزمة من التجمع. إذا تم حذفها، يتم ترك أي مراجع حزمة موجودة دون تغيير.

certificateReferences

قائمة بالشهادات التي سيتم تثبيتها على كل عقدة حساب في التجمع. إذا كان هذا العنصر موجودا، فإنه يحل محل أي مراجع شهادة موجودة تم تكوينها على التجمع. إذا تم حذفها، يتم ترك أي مراجع شهادة موجودة دون تغيير. بالنسبة إلى Windows Nodes، تقوم خدمة Batch بتثبيت الشهادات إلى مخزن الشهادات والموقع المحددين. بالنسبة لعقد حساب Linux، يتم تخزين الشهادات في دليل داخل دليل عمل المهمة ويتم توفير متغير بيئة AZ_BATCH_CERTIFICATES_DIR للمهمة للاستعلام عن هذا الموقع. بالنسبة للشهادات التي لها رؤية "remoteUser"، يتم إنشاء دليل "certs" في الدليل الرئيسي للمستخدم (على سبيل المثال، /home/{user-name}/certs) ويتم وضع الشهادات في هذا الدليل.

metadata

قائمة أزواج الاسم والقيمة المقترنة بالتجمع كبيانات تعريف. إذا كان هذا العنصر موجودا، فإنه يحل محل أي بيانات تعريف موجودة تم تكوينها على التجمع. إذا قمت بتحديد مجموعة فارغة، تتم إزالة أي بيانات تعريف من التجمع. إذا تم حذفها، يتم ترك أي بيانات تعريف موجودة دون تغيير.

startTask

مهمة لتشغيلها على كل عقدة حساب أثناء انضمامها إلى التجمع. يتم تشغيل المهمة عند إضافة عقدة الحساب إلى التجمع أو عند إعادة تشغيل عقدة الحساب. إذا كان هذا العنصر موجودا، فإنه يقوم بالكتابة فوق أي StartTask موجود. إذا تم حذفها، يتم ترك أي StartTask موجودة دون تغيير.

تفاصيل الخاصية

applicationPackageReferences

قائمة الحزم التي سيتم تثبيتها على كل عقدة حساب في التجمع. تؤثر التغييرات على مراجع الحزمة على جميع العقد الجديدة التي تنضم إلى التجمع، ولكن لا تؤثر على حساب العقد الموجودة بالفعل في التجمع حتى يتم إعادة تمهيدها أو إعادة تصورها. إذا كان هذا العنصر موجودا، فإنه يحل محل أي مراجع حزمة موجودة. إذا قمت بتحديد مجموعة فارغة، فستتم إزالة كافة مراجع الحزمة من التجمع. إذا تم حذفها، يتم ترك أي مراجع حزمة موجودة دون تغيير.

applicationPackageReferences?: ApplicationPackageReference[]

قيمة الخاصية

certificateReferences

قائمة بالشهادات التي سيتم تثبيتها على كل عقدة حساب في التجمع. إذا كان هذا العنصر موجودا، فإنه يحل محل أي مراجع شهادة موجودة تم تكوينها على التجمع. إذا تم حذفها، يتم ترك أي مراجع شهادة موجودة دون تغيير. بالنسبة إلى Windows Nodes، تقوم خدمة Batch بتثبيت الشهادات إلى مخزن الشهادات والموقع المحددين. بالنسبة لعقد حساب Linux، يتم تخزين الشهادات في دليل داخل دليل عمل المهمة ويتم توفير متغير بيئة AZ_BATCH_CERTIFICATES_DIR للمهمة للاستعلام عن هذا الموقع. بالنسبة للشهادات التي لها رؤية "remoteUser"، يتم إنشاء دليل "certs" في الدليل الرئيسي للمستخدم (على سبيل المثال، /home/{user-name}/certs) ويتم وضع الشهادات في هذا الدليل.

certificateReferences?: CertificateReference[]

قيمة الخاصية

metadata

قائمة أزواج الاسم والقيمة المقترنة بالتجمع كبيانات تعريف. إذا كان هذا العنصر موجودا، فإنه يحل محل أي بيانات تعريف موجودة تم تكوينها على التجمع. إذا قمت بتحديد مجموعة فارغة، تتم إزالة أي بيانات تعريف من التجمع. إذا تم حذفها، يتم ترك أي بيانات تعريف موجودة دون تغيير.

metadata?: MetadataItem[]

قيمة الخاصية

startTask

مهمة لتشغيلها على كل عقدة حساب أثناء انضمامها إلى التجمع. يتم تشغيل المهمة عند إضافة عقدة الحساب إلى التجمع أو عند إعادة تشغيل عقدة الحساب. إذا كان هذا العنصر موجودا، فإنه يقوم بالكتابة فوق أي StartTask موجود. إذا تم حذفها، يتم ترك أي StartTask موجودة دون تغيير.

startTask?: StartTask

قيمة الخاصية